Zühlke vs Arnia Software: overview

Zühlke

Zühlke is a Swiss product-innovation engineering group founded in 1968 in Schlieren (near Zurich), Switzerland, with 1,900+ employees across 17 locations in Europe and Asia. Partner-owned rather than private-equity or public-market backed, it applies machine learning within a broader practice spanning cloud, data platforms, and cybersecurity, serving medtech, financial services, and industrial clients across its multi-decade history.

Arnia Software

Arnia Software is a Bucharest, Romania R&D and engineering firm founded in 2006, with reported team size varying by source (roughly 200–500 employees) across three development centers plus a US office in Irvine, California. Its machine learning expertise grew out of original R&D work in database engines and operating systems, giving it systems-level engineering depth alongside enterprise application, big data, mobile, web, and social-platform development.

Zühlke vs Arnia Software: pros and cons

Zühlke
+ 56 years of continuous operation (founded 1968) — by far the longest-established firm in this list
+ 1,900+ employees across 17 locations in Europe and Asia give exceptional delivery scale and geographic reach
+ Partner-owned structure, not private-equity or public-market owned, supports long-term client relationships
+ Broad practice spanning AI, cloud, data platforms, and cybersecurity suits complex, multi-discipline enterprise programs
- AI/ML is a relatively small specialization within a much larger, more general engineering-innovation practice
- Enterprise-consulting scale and pricing make it a poor fit for smaller pilot-stage buyers
- Being one of the largest, most established firms on this list means less boutique-style founder-level AI focus
Arnia Software
+ R&D roots in database engines and operating systems give genuine systems-level engineering depth
+ Three development centers and a US office (Irvine, California) support both EU and US-facing engagements
+ Founded 2006 — nearly two decades of continuous operation
+ Broad service range from mobile and web apps to big data systems alongside ML
- Reported team size varies significantly by source, ranging from roughly 238 to 500+ employees, making capacity hard to pin down precisely
- Machine learning is described as part of R&D project history rather than a dedicated, named current practice area
- Public case studies with named enterprise clients and outcome metrics are limited
